What's an IRA Gold Account?


An IRA gold account is a specialized kind of Particular person Retirement Account that allows investors to hold physical gold, silver, platinum, and palladium. Unlike conventional IRAs that typically hold paper belongings like stocks and bonds, an IRA gold account allows for the inclusion of tangible belongings, providing a hedge against inflation and economic instability.

To establish an IRA gold account, investors should work with a custodian who focuses on precious metals. The custodian is responsible for managing the account, ensuring compliance with IRS regulations, and safeguarding the physical metals. Investors can select to roll over funds from an present retirement account or contribute new funds to set up their gold IRA.
Benefits of an IRA Gold Account

Inflation Hedge: Gold has traditionally been considered as a safe haven during periods of economic uncertainty and inflation. In contrast to paper foreign money, gold tends to retain its worth over time, making it a horny option for preserving purchasing energy in retirement.

Diversification: Including gold in an funding portfolio can improve diversification. Traditional property like stocks and bonds could also be correlated with market fluctuations, however gold typically strikes independently of these assets. This diversification might help mitigate risk and stabilize returns.

Tax Benefits: An IRA gold account gives tax-deferred progress, that means that investors don't pay taxes on good points until they withdraw funds during retirement. Within the case of a Roth IRA gold account, certified withdrawals can be tax-free.

Protection Against Market Volatility: Gold has historically demonstrated a adverse correlation with inventory market performance. During occasions of market downturns, gold often will increase in value, offering a buffer for investors' retirement portfolios.

Tangible Asset: In contrast to stocks or bonds, gold is a bodily asset that investors can hold. This tangibility can present a sense of security, significantly in occasions of economic turmoil when confidence in financial institutions might wane.

Issues Before Opening an IRA Gold Account


While there are quite a few benefits to an IRA gold account, potential buyers must also consider a number of components before proceeding.
Custodian Fees: Establishing an IRA gold account typically involves custodian fees. These fees can differ significantly between custodians and should include setup charges, annual maintenance charges, and storage charges for the physical metals. It can be crucial to grasp the price structure and how it's going to impression total funding returns.

Limited Funding Options: An IRA gold account is restricted to specific sorts of valuable metals that meet IRS requirements. For gold, this sometimes means only bullion coins and bars which might be at least 99.5% pure. This restriction could restrict an investor's capability to diversify inside the precious metals market.

Storage Necessities: The IRS mandates that bodily gold held in an IRA should be saved in a secure investment in precious metals ira, authorised depository. Buyers cannot take possession of the gold till they attain retirement age, which could also be a downside for many who prefer to have direct entry to their property.

Market Risks: Whereas gold can be a hedge towards inflation, it is not immune to market risks. The worth of gold might be volatile, influenced by elements equivalent to geopolitical events, modifications in curiosity charges, and shifts in investor sentiment. Buyers ought to be prepared for potential fluctuations in the worth of their gold holdings.

Regulatory Compliance: Investing in an IRA gold account requires adherence to particular IRS regulations. Failure to comply with these regulations may end up in penalties and taxes. It is essential for investors to work with educated custodians and advisors to make sure they remain compliant.

Methods to Arrange an IRA Gold Account


Setting up an IRA gold account includes several steps:
Select a Custodian: Analysis and select a custodian that focuses on precious metals IRAs. Search for a custodian with a stable repute, transparent price structures, and wonderful customer service.

Open the Account: Complete the necessary paperwork to ascertain your IRA gold account. This may increasingly involve providing personal info, deciding on beneficiaries, and choosing between a conventional or Roth IRA.

Fund the Account: You'll be able to fund your IRA gold account by means of a rollover from an present retirement account or by making new contributions. Ensure that you understand the contribution limits and tax implications of your funding technique.

Select Your Metals: Work along with your custodian to choose the precise gold and different precious metals you wish to spend money on. Ensure that the chosen metals meet IRS requirements for purity and eligibility.

Storage Preparations: Your custodian will arrange for the secure storage of your physical metals in an approved depository. You'll receive regular statements detailing your holdings and their worth.
